Orange County Resolution to approve 2592 <br /> and execute MOU <br /> PURPOSE: To adopt a resolution approving amendments to an existing Memorandum of <br /> Understanding (MOU) between the Town of Carrboro and Orange County regarding the provision <br /> of Erosion Control services by Orange County to the Town as requested by the Town to support <br /> its Stormwater and Erosion Control program, its delegated authority granted by the North Carolina <br /> Environmental Management Commission (NC EMC), and the Town's mandated program <br /> requirements administered by the North Carolina Department of Environmental Quality(NC DEQ). <br /> BACKGROUND: In 1976, Orange County entered into an MOU with the Town of Carrboro for <br /> the County to provide enforcement of the Town's Erosion and Sedimentation Control (E&SC) <br /> regulations (existing MOU provided at Attachment 1). The County has provided those <br /> professional and technical services for over 49 years to the satisfaction of both parties. Since that <br /> original agreement, however, Town, County, and State requirements, programs, laws, and <br /> ordinances have substantially changed. Orange County has the "delegated authority" granted by <br /> the NC EMC for administering an Erosion Control Program. With this delegated authority coupled <br /> with the MOU, Orange County provides regulation of construction site runoff for Carrboro's <br /> Municipal Separate Storm Sewer System (MS4) program. The MOU helps meet the mandated <br /> federal and state requirements of the National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(NPDES) <br /> under the U.S. Clean Water Act. <br /> NC DEQ conducts audits of the Carrboro's MS4 Program, which is a requirement to maintain its <br /> state-delegated authority. In its 2025 audit preparation, the State recommended that the existing <br /> MOU be updated to reflect current regulations, professional terms, best practices, and the current <br /> working state of the agreement. Both Carrboro and County staffs worked together to revise and <br /> update the MOU (proposed MOU provided at Attachment 2). <br />
